About The Position

Vaco Technology is currently seeking an ERP Manager (D365 F&O / SCM) for a Direct-Hire opportunity that is located in Addison, TX 75001 (4-5 days per week onsite). The ERP Manager (D365 F&O / SCM) is responsible for the D365 F&O Product and serves as a liaison between Technical and Business Teams by facilitating effective communication and determining the best software objectives that align with the business needs. Additionally, the ERP Manager (D365 F&O / SCM) will identify, define, and document business processes and software requirements.
